@@ -0,0 +1,36 @@
"""
Utility library containing operations used/shared by multiple CourseBlocks.
"""
def yield_dynamic_descriptor_descendants(descriptor, user_id, block_creator=None):
"""
This returns all of the descendants of a descriptor. If the descriptor
has dynamic children, the block will be created using block_creator
and the children (as descriptors) of that module will be returned.
"""
stack = [descriptor]
while len(stack) > 0:
next_descriptor = stack.pop()
stack.extend(get_dynamic_descriptor_children(next_descriptor, user_id, block_creator))
yield next_descriptor
def get_dynamic_descriptor_children(descriptor, user_id, block_creator=None, usage_key_filter=None):
"""
Returns the children of the given descriptor, while supporting descriptors with dynamic children.
"""
block_children = []
if descriptor.has_dynamic_children():
block = None
if descriptor.scope_ids.user_id and user_id == descriptor.scope_ids.user_id:
# do not rebind the block if it's already bound to a user.
block = descriptor
elif block_creator:
block = block_creator(descriptor)
if block:
block_children = block.get_child_descriptors()
else:
block_children = descriptor.get_children(usage_key_filter)
return block_children
